Blockchain & Crypto

Worst may be behind Bitcoin, say City analysts, although volatility is back

Volatility is back in the crypto space according to City analysts, as Bitcoin breaks past US$23,000.

The largest coin by market cap has gained 1.54% in the last 24 hours to US$23,056. Bitcoin also rallied beyond US$23,000 over the weekend.

“This has certainly made many believe that the worst could be behind us when it comes to the BTC price,” said Naeem Aslam, a market analyst at Avatrade. “However, traders are still sceptical about the bottom being firmly in place. This is because the BTC price needs to break above the US$30,000 price mark, which is a major resistance for now.”

Ethereum, on the other hand, was little changed, gaining 0.06% since yesterday morning to US$1,635.

“These are the highest levels seen for bitcoin and ether since August 19; this was after the majority of the damage caused by the failure of Terra and the bankruptcies of Three Arrows Capital, Celsius, and others,” Aslam added. “Nonetheless, hopes are pinned on Fed’s dovish monetary policy stance and more weakness in the dollar index."

According to Craig Erlam, a senior market analyst at Oanda, “volatility is back.”

“It’s been a very choppy week for bitcoin after the cryptocurrency surged back to life, buoyed by a much-improved risk environment,” he said. “A period of relative calm in the crypto space has allowed for such a rebound, time clearly being a great healer and all that.

“Still, as we've seen in crypto, the volatility works both ways and what we've seen this past week suggests there's plenty more to come.”

In some of the altcoins, BNB was up 4.2% to US$316.86, Polkadot surged 5.17% to US$6.63 and Avalanche gained 5.31% to US$18.58.
